Measurement knowledge

How to determine soil pH:
Before planting, try to collect soil from different locations on the land for analysis to ensure that the soil samples taken are representative and analyze whether the pH of the soil meets the pH requirements of the crop.
- 1. First remove about 5 cm of the top soil to be tested; then mash the soil down to a depth of 13 cm. And clean up all organic impurities in the soil that will affect the test results, such as leaves, roots, etc.
- 2. Soak the soil with water and turn it into mud. (Use rainwater or distilled water)
- 3. Set the function key to the right position.
- 4. Wet the probe. Wipe the right one of the three probes with a cleaning pad.
- 5. Insert the probe completely into the tested soil.
- 6. Wait for 1 minute to read the data.
- 7. After the test, wipe the probe and dry it. 8. If you need to continue to analyze other soils, please repeat the above steps.
How to analyze soil fertility:
Fertile soil is a necessary condition for a good crop harvest. Animal and plant residues contain a large amount of organic matter and humus in the soil. The fertile soil has a good structure, the soil quality is neither loose, nor sticky, has good water permeability, and its pH value is suitable for plant growth, and it is rich in a large number of elements (nitrogen, phosphorus, potassium) and micronutrient elements (boron) required for plant growth. , Copper, iron, sulfur, magnesium, molybdenum, etc.).
- 1. First remove the topsoil about 5 cm; then mash the soil down to a depth of 13 cm. And clean up all organic impurities in the soil that will affect the test results, such as leaves, roots, etc.
- 2. Soak the soil with water and mix thoroughly to form a muddy shape. (Use rainwater or distilled water).
- 3. Wipe the probe clean with a clean cotton or paper towel.
- 4. Move the function key to the first gear from the left.
- 5. Insert the probe into the tested soil until the distance between the soil and the body does not exceed 2.5 cm. Wait no more than 10 seconds, and the data can be read after the pointer is stable.
- 6. Record the data. Remove the probe from the soil and clean the probe thoroughly.
- 7. If you need to continue to analyze other soils, please repeat the above steps.
Result analysis:
"Too little" means you need to spread fertilizer
- 1. The fertilizers dissolved in water, then water combined with added nutrients to crops;
- 2. Plant or transplanting plant watering should be combined with three weeks after fertilization, and each month when watering plants do.
"Ideal" means ok.
- Combining with the watering, fertilizing once a month
"Too much" means no need fertilizer currently.
- Just watering;
- You will plant to transplanting to the new soil;
- For the plants in the greenhouse, should be a lot of water, dilute nutrient leaching too much;
- Don't let any chemical fertilizer, but can be applied into the manure, compost, plant residues, etc.
